Dengue Surveillance in Guadeloupe and the Northern Islands. Update as of April 22, 2020.

Epidemiological Situation

Guadeloupe: ongoing epidemic. The predominant circulating serotype is serotype 2. Since early April, dengue surveillance indicators have been rising again.

Saint Martin: ongoing epidemic. The predominant circulating serotype is serotype 1. Dengue surveillance indicators remain high.

Saint Barthélemy: resurgence of biologically confirmed cases. The predominant circulating serotype is serotype 2. Dengue surveillance indicators are on the rise.
The situation should be monitored closely, and a reassessment of the PSAGE phase, in coordination with the CEMIE, should be considered.
